hello to all 🙂 

As some of you know that my mk8 fiesta was rear ended last year and written off, now I'm a Corsa F owner, 1.2 130ps .

just decided to share my experience in case any one thinking to switch to Corsa, you would lose too much fun !!

Corsa's Engine, that 1.2 turbocharged french puretech engine is much more powerful than the 1.0 ecoboost , but its fuel economy is way off behind what ecoboost offers !! expect more fuel consumption, I tried every thing I could but I couldn't get near to what ecoboost offers really in terms of fuel economy.

The most important aspect actually is the handling and control, I'm convinced now that nothing beats the superior handling and the " fun to drive " attitude of your fiesta , don't get me wrong , the corsa performs well, but not like a fiesta, specially around corners, the fiesta feels more rigid and grown up, and gives you much more confidence than the corsa , at every corner the corsa starts to lose control at a much lower speed than a fiesta, and the ESP kicks in more often.

Mates, you have the sweetest and the most fun to drive car in its class, and if , and only if , there is still brand new fiesta being sold here in Egypt I wouldn't have bought a Corsa !!

Be proud of what you have , be proud of Ford Fiesta 🙂

Interesting comments, Ahmad. You get a much more powerful version there, by the way - the petrol Corsa is only available with maximum of 100ps in the UK, the most powerful model on offer here being the electric one!

Very interesting. so many people spend their time trying to find faults with drivel instead of focusing on the fundamental things that matter.

 We had the Corsa as a Pool Car a few years back, a bottom of the range Diesel one, and the  Engine and Gearbox were very good and a pleasure to drive for a bottom of the range car. 

The handling was not great as you say though and the build quality was not that good, small bits of trim started to need fixed after a short time.

Yes its a powerful engine, with 230 NM of torque available early at 1750 rpm, but only mated with a 6 speed auto, different from the 8 speed you get in UK.

That french corsa has a good build quality , much better than previous GM corsa, may be little bit better than the mk8 fiesta, specially the door trim feels more rigid and holding itself together without any rattles or clicks.

but when it comes to handling really Fiesta wins , I have the corsa now for about 5 months and still can't understand its behavior during heavy cornering, it understeers until a certain limit then suddenly begins to oversteer !! fiesta gives you great confidence in that area, I don't remember the ESP kicked in any time in Fiesta, but in corsa it kicks in more often, to the extent that I think without ESP its handling would be compared to GO KART 😄
